관리-도구
편집 파일: test_op.cpython-38.pyc
U 0?�f? � @ s� d Z ddlmZ ddlmZ ddlmZ ddlmZ ddlmZ ddlmZ dd l m Z dd l mZ e�ed�dd � �Z G dd� de e�ZdS )z-Test against the builders in the op.* module.� )�Column)�event)�Integer)�String)�Table)�text� )�AlterColRoundTripFixture)�TestBaseZafter_parent_attachc C s | j dkr| �tdt�� d S )NZtbl_with_auto_appended_column�bat)�name� append_columnr r )�table�metadata� r �K/opt/hc_python/lib/python3.8/site-packages/alembic/testing/suite/test_op.py� _add_cols s r c @ s@ e Zd ZdZdd� Zdd� Zdd� Zdd � Zd d� Zdd � Z dS )�BackendAlterColumnTestTc C s | � i ddi� d S )Nr Znewname��_run_alter_col��selfr r r �test_rename_column s z)BackendAlterColumnTest.test_rename_columnc C s | � dt� idtd�i� d S )N�type�2 )r r r r r r r �test_modify_type_int_str s z/BackendAlterColumnTest.test_modify_type_int_strc C s | � dtidtd�i� d S )Nr �server_default�5�r r r r r r r �test_add_server_default_int s z2BackendAlterColumnTest.test_add_server_default_intc C s"